Eric Jason Brandwine of Haymarket VA (US)
Executive Summary
Eric Jason Brandwine of Haymarket VA (US) is an inventor who has filed 6 patents. Their primary areas of innovation include {Hypervisor-specific management and integration aspects} (2 patents), Internet protocol [IP] addresses (2 patents), Configuration management of networks or network elements (address allocation (2 patents), and they have worked with companies such as Amazon Technologies, Inc. (6 patents). Their most frequent collaborators include (4 collaborations), (2 collaborations), (1 collaborations).
